The Patriots filled their practice squad by signing two running backs on Tuesday.
Jonathan Ward and Rushawn Baker were added the practice squad, and Jashuan Corbin was placed on practice squad injured reserve.
The Patriots also had an open spot on their practice squad after outside linebacker Truman Jones was signed to the Titans’ 53-man roster.
Ward, 28, spent time on the Titans in 2022 and 2023 while Mike Vrabel was head coach. The 6-feet, 202-pound running back has 22 career carries for 91 yards and six catches for 52 yards and a touchdown since entering the NFL as an undrafted free agent out of Central Michigan in 2020. He’s also spent time with the Cardinals, Jets, Steelers and Giants.
Baker, 22, is an undrafted rookie out of Elon. He’s also spent time with the Giants.
